Typical penetration testing and vulnerability assessment activities
  • Project initiation and technical information gathering
  • Identification of theoretical attack scenarios from analysis of information provided
  • Vulnerability assessment from theoretical attack scenarios
  • Selection of attack scenarios to be carried out
  • Vulnerability assessment from applying actual attack scenarios
  • Detailed reporting, and delivery of support material for further audits and risk mitigation
  • Detailed remediation plan addressing the issues raised during the assessment process
